Serie A: Lautaro's Hattrick Fires Inter Milan Past Lowly Salernitana Into Top Spot

Argentine striker Lautaro Martinez silenced critics with a hat-trick to fire Inter Milan into the top of Serie A on Friday with a 5-0 win over bottom-side Salernitana.

The result edges Inter a point clear of Napoli and AC Milan in a tight three-way title race with all three sides having played 27 matches.

Inter were on a five-game winless run so Friday's romp is a boost ahead of their midweek return-leg Champions League last-16 clash with Liverpool, who lead 2-0 from their win in Milan last month.

Argentine striker Martinez punched the ground in frustration after smacking a volley off the crossbar in the 20th minute.

But two minutes later he was punching the air in triumph after beating the off-side trap and slotting the opener into the far corner.

He was on target twice more with thumping strikes just before the break and ten minutes into the second half.

He did, however, leave the pitch on 90 minutes holding his left thigh gingerly.

Edin Dzeko added a brace from two poached chances inside the six-yard box on 64th and 69th minutes to wrap things up.

Napoli and AC Milan face off on Sunday night as another instalment of an enthralling title race unfold in Naples.

Chasing a first league crown since the days of Diego Maradona, a sold-out stadium that bears their hero's name will host two teams locked on 57 points, with Napoli ahead of Milan on goal difference.
